Dear Friends of Living Arts,

What an exciting year Living Arts has had!  I was very pleased to come on board in April to join such a great team of people truly making a difference in Tulsa.  I want to thank you for welcoming me to this organization with such warmth.  I have witnessed and been a part of so much growth within the past eight months, and I am constantly amazed at the time and effort Living Arts Board Members and Patrons give to the various programs and events.
Part of this growth has been the renovations made to the Brady location, which has taken much planning from our board, staff and community volunteers.  Thank you to those of you who have been involved thus far in the process!  However, there is much more we need to do in order to utilize the space to its full advantage.  As you know, Living Arts provides many cutting-edge exhibitions and programs, as well as free innovative arts education programming to area youth.  Currently, the Brady location is in need of funds to continue renovations for the education side of the building.  Phase 2 will include projects such as Office Spaces, Kitchen, Performing Arts Education Space, and Multidisciplinary Arts Education Space.
As you make your end of the year charitable contributions, I ask you to consider giving an extra gift to Living Arts this year-so that we can raise money to continue the renovations on our beautiful new space.  You can make a difference in our ongoing efforts to provide a true contemporary arts center-and quality space for our children to learn and be involved in art.

A sincere thank you from Steve and myself, and our Board of Directors.

Linda Litton Clark
Administrative Director
